Kā lietot Javascript ar Excel

click fraud protection
...

Izveidojiet Excel izklājlapas, izmantojot Javascript.

Javascript valoda izstrādātājiem nodrošina rīkus dinamiska satura iestatīšanai pēc tam, kad tīmekļa lapa ir ielādēta lietotāja tīmekļa pārlūkprogrammā. Varat izmantot programmu Excel ar Javascript un ģenerēt izklājlapu saviem tīmekļa lasītājiem. Tiek atvērta Excel izklājlapa ar jūsu norādīto saturu, un lietotājs var izvēlēties lasīt, rediģēt un saglabāt failu datorā. Tas ir noderīgi tīmekļa izstrādātājiem, kuri savās tīmekļa lapās vēlas ātri izveidot Excel izklājlapas.

1. darbība

Izveidojiet savu Javascript bloku. Šis bloks norāda tīmekļa pārlūkprogrammai, ka ietvertais kods ir izpildāmi skripti. Pievienojiet šādu kodu starp "

" un "" tagi jūsu HTML tīmekļa lapā:

Dienas video

Visi jūsu Javascript, kas saskaras ar Excel, tiek ievietoti šajos skriptu blokos.

2. darbība

Sāciet Excel lietojumprogrammas mainīgo. Šis mainīgais ielādē Excel bibliotēkas, kas tiek izmantotas mijiedarbībai ar Excel. Šis kods sāk jūsu mainīgo:

var excel = jauns ActiveXObject ("Excel. Pieteikums" ); excel.visible = patiess;

3. darbība

Izveidojiet izklājlapu un aktivizējiet to. Pēc Excel mainīgā inicializācijas jums ir jāizveido darbgrāmata un darblapa, kas ir Excel faila komponenti, kas satur jūsu informāciju. Šis kods izveido izklājlapu:

var grāmata = Excel. Darba burtnīcas. Pievienot; grāmatu. Darba lapas. Pievienot; grāmatu. Darba lapas (1).Aktivizēt;

4. darbība

Uzrakstiet tekstu Excel darblapā. Varat aizpildīt katru izklājlapas rindu pa rindiņai. Šajā piemērā pirmā šūna ir iestatīta virknes vērtībai:

grāmatu. Worksheets (1).Cells (1,1).value="Mana pirmā izklājlapa";

5. darbība

Saglabājiet Excel failu. Šī ir izvēles darbība, un lietotājam tiek atvērta uzvedne "Saglabāt kā". Lietotājam tiek jautāts, vai viņš vēlas saglabāt failu un kurā mapē fails ir saglabāts. Ja rakstāt iekšēju pieteikumu uzņēmumam, varat iestatīt pārlūkprogrammas drošību tā, lai tas nepārprotami atļautu dokumentam saglabājiet cietajā diskā bez lietotāja mijiedarbības, taču tas rada drošības apdraudējumu ārējiem tīmekļa apmeklētājiem, kuri neuzticas vietne. Šis kods jautā lietotājam, vai viņš vēlas saglabāt failu:

grāmatu. Darblapas (1).SaveAs("C:\excel_file. XLS");